You must never modify parts from the product or use parts not recommended by Ryobi, this may increase the risk of serious injury to yourself or others. WARNING Always ensure that ventilation openings are kept clear of debris;...
  • Page 5 Contact with the cutting mechanism. Keep unprotected WARNING body parts away from the cutting mechanism at all times. Do not put your hands up inside the shredder’s discharge chute to clear away shredded material while the product is switched on or connected to the mains supply.   • Page 27 PRODUCT SPECIFICATIONS Rated power 2400W(S6, 40%), 2000W(S1) Rated voltage 230-240V ~50Hz Maximum cutting diameter 45 mm Idle speed 40 min Weight 28.8 kg Noise emission level (in accordance with EN 13683:2003+A2:2011/AC:2013 Annex F) A-weighted sound pressure 80.7 dB(A) level at operator’s position Uncertainty of measurement 2.5 dB A-weighted sound power level...
